Merge branch 'js/regexec-buf' into maint
Some codepaths in "git diff" used regexec(3) on a buffer that was mmap(2)ed, which may not have a terminating NUL, leading to a read beyond the end of the mapped region. This was fixed by introducing a regexec_buf() helper that takes a <ptr,len> pair with REG_STARTEND extension. * js/regexec-buf: regex: use regexec_buf() regex: add regexec_buf() that can work on a non NUL-terminated string regex: -G<pattern> feeds a non NUL-terminated string to regexec() and fails
